@article{discovery1316, number = {20}, year = {2004}, month = {October}, journal = {J PHYS B-AT MOL OPT}, publisher = {IOP PUBLISHING LTD}, volume = {37}, pages = {L343 -- L350}, title = {Electron-H-3(+) collisions at intermediate energies}, url = {https://discovery.ucl.ac.uk/id/eprint/1316/}, issn = {0953-4075}, abstract = {A new procedure is presented for the ab initio study of electron-molecule collision at energies straddling the target ionization threshold. The R-matrix with pseudostates method, which allows for the inclusion of discretized continuum states in a close-coupling expansion, is adapted to molecular targets using even-tempered basis sets. Calculations for electron collisions with the H-3(+) molecular ion provide converged polarizabilities, electronic excitation and ionization cross sections.}, keywords = {DISSOCIATIVE EXCITATION, IMPACT IONIZATION, SCATTERING, RECOMBINATION, CONVERGENCE, H-3(+), MODEL}, author = {Gorfinkiel, JD and Tennyson, J} }
